## Introduce per-tenant rate quotas in the Orvane gateway

For the release manager: this change replaces our global throttle with per-tenant quotas, resolved at request time from the tenant registry and cached for sixty seconds. Tenants without an explicit quota inherit the tier default; overage returns a retryable status with a hint header. Rollout is gated behind a flag, defaulting off, and the old throttle remains as a backstop until two clean release cycles pass.

The initial tier defaults we intend to ship are listed below.

limits module of taguf-hafog:
WEIGHTS = {
    "wenox": 690,
    "wenok": 782,
    "kelax": 41,
    "holox": 338,
    "quenir": 39,
}

Briefing — Leadership Review, Tindale Fabrics

Procurement has shortlisted two candidate second-source suppliers for the Weftline yarn range after the Quarrow mill capacity issues. Vetting completes next month; cost deltas look manageable. Finance should hold contingency in Q2 forecasts. The confidential commercial intent behind this search is set out directly below.

management briefing: Project Ulavan slips by two quarters because of the staffing delay.

## Changelog — Paylark v4.12

Heads up, reviewers: we changed the default behavior for payment retries. Previously, idempotency keys were optional and only generated when the client passed one in. That bit us twice last quarter when Fennwick's batch jobs double-charged on timeout retries. Now every retry path in Paylark mints a key server-side and persists it for 48 hours, so duplicate captures get rejected at the gateway shim. Nothing changes for clients already sending keys. The new defaults we're shipping are as follows.

service settings:
[quenath]
host = quenath.zemvarcorp.corp
user = quenath_svc
database = quenath_prod